[2] Plcmnt Auto Adjust
This function is available only when the double beam recognition has been set in the pattern
program.
Disable
The double beam recognition is always performed.
Enable
When pressed, the double beam recognition is performed with the interval based on the
data in the machine. Normally, single beam recognition is performed using the recognition
results using the double beam as the correction values. The cycle time can be reduced with
this function.
[3] Auto teaching during running
The automatic teaching during the machine operation is set up in this selection box.
Head Cntr Teach Mode
The auto teaching for rotating center of head is performed during operation at regular time
interval to secure the placement accuracy. Select the auto teaching mode from the following
options.
1PCB: The teaching is performed per PCB after completing placement.
Place Cycle: The teaching is performed per place cycle.
Head Cntr Teach Tolerance
Select teach tolerance for rotating center of head from the following options.
10 μm (Standard), 30 μm, 50 μm, 80 μm
NL-Axis Org Teach Mode
"Enable" or "Disable" for the NL-axis Origin Teaching, is setup in this data box.
NL-Axis Org Teach Interval
When “Enable“ is selected for NL-Axis Org Teach Mode, select the teaching time interval
from the following options.
Auto, 5 min, 10 min, 30 min
Chute Mark Compen
"Enable" or "Disable" for Chute Mark Compen, is setup in this data box.

[4] "Component Remain Mode" Group Box
The component remainder management function (mode) is used to count the number of
components picked from the feeder, manage it, and provide the related information.
Func Set
Disable
Select this button not to use the component remainder management mode.
Enable
Select this button to use the component remainder management mode.
When the [Enable] button is selected, an alarm will be issued, indicating that the machine
will soon be short or empty of components.
Zero Stop Func
Disable
When this button is pressed, the feeder does not stop working after the number of remaining
components has reached "0" (zero).
Splicing
When this button is pressed and the number of remaining components has reached "0" (zero), the
deficiency is regarded as a component shortage error and the feeder stops working.
In this case, it is required to reload the components afterward.
ALL
When this button is pressed and the number of remaining components has reached "0" (zero) for all
feeders, the deficiency is regarded as a component shortage error and the feeder (the machine)
stops working.
Stock stick Only
When this button is pressed and the number of remaining components has reached “0” (zero) for
stock stick feeder, the deficiency is regarded as a component shortage error and the feeder stops
working.
Stk stick+Splicing
When this button is pressed and the number of remaining components has reached “0” (zero) for
stock stick feeder or splicing feeder, the deficiency is regarded as a component shortage error and
the feeder stops working.
